Remove the bottom pin

Bifold doors are great for saving space in closets but they may begin to slide or scratch against the floor or fall out of their brackets. The good news is that you are able to solve the issue by making a few minor adjustments.

The most common problem is the bottom pin that gets loose or slips out of its bracket. You can correct this by pressing the spring-loaded wheel on the top of the door and then swivelling the door in a position to align it with the bottom track. Once the gap is equal you can tighten the screw that holds the top pivot point bracket to hold the door in position.

A typical issue is when the edge of the door's bottom scrapes against the carpet. It could be due to the addition of carpet or other flooring materials. It could also be due to an uneven gap between the door and side jambs on hinges. It is possible to fix this by loosening up the top guide, sliding it sideways or removing the pivot point on top.

The last issue that is common is when the track is misaligned with the door frame, and this can be solved by loosening the top set screw and adjusting it out as necessary. After you've adjusted all the nuts and bolts holding the track in place, you should be in a position to slide it back into its track bracket and secure it with the screw.

To remove the bottom pin take both panels at the sides and lift them slightly off the track below and off of their brackets. Release the locking levers on the bottom bracket to let the pin go. If the pin does not have a bracket for mounting, you can attach a screw with a flat head between the bottom of the pivot flange and the door to pull the pin out of the door. Once you can get an ensconced hold on the pin, turn it left and right, while pulling it out of the door. If you aren't able to pull the pin out, you may need to remove the panel from the track. If this is the case, put it on a set of saw horses to make it easier to move.

Remove the pin with the highest point.

They are great for saving space, but can be frustrating when they begin to sag or scrape the floor or even veer off track. Simple adjustments will often bring them back in line.

If the doors move unevenly then loosen the screw that is on the pivot point on the top of the bracket and move it a bit. Close the door to see whether it is aligned with the frame. If it does, tighten the screw.

The bottoms of bifold internal doors are often scraped by the carpet. If this is the case, you can try raising the bottom of the door with the bottom pin adjustment. If the door is too high, you'll need to take it off and trim them with a saw.

The wood around pivot pins and anchors could get damaged over time. It is possible to apply epoxy to repair Bifold door top pivot (https://chardquilt09.bravejournal.net/why-we-are-in-love-with-bifold-door-seal-repair-and-you-should-too) the crack and stop it from becoming worse. Simply apply a small amount of epoxy to the crack and let it set before using the door again.

If your bifold door repairs near me doors aren't closing properly or aligning properly with the frame it could be due to the fact that they're too far apart. You can fix this by moving top of the door up or down on the track.

It's not easy to do this project on your own, so you'll need an assistant. Pick up the exterior and interior panels of the door on the sides. Then lift them. They can be stacked to make for less difficult handling.

If there are locking levers on the pivot bracket, release the levers. If not take the top of the pin with a pair of vise grips and twist it from left to right, while pulling it out. Repeat the procedure on the other side of the door. After both pins have been removed the door will then open and align with the track. If it doesn't, you can put the doors back in place and try again. You can use a drill to straighten the track if it is bent.

Reinstall the bottom pin

If the bottom pin isn't working correctly, the door could be stuck, preventing it from opening and closing smoothly. Fortunately, it is usually an easy fix. Most of the time, a loose or missing mounting screw is to blame. If this is the case, it's best to replace bifold doors the screw by a new one that is the same size. Then, screw it into place and tighten it.

If you want to get more serious about your bifold door repair project, you can use a device like an air pressure gauge to test for proper compression of the top pin that is spring-loaded. The gauge is also helpful in determining whether the pin itself is broken or cracked, which is important information to have if you're planning on replacing it with a replacement part.

An excellent way to determine whether the current pivot pin is damaged or worn out is by measuring its diameter as well as the diameter of the pin cap. Compare the measurements to what you can find online for replacements. This will help you to locate the right parts for your door.

Before you replace the pivot pin to the doors, open them and lean them against each to ensure that they're in the correct position for installation. If you're using a set of knobs for closet doors, carefully draw a line of level down the middle of the leading edge of each door. Make use of a long level to mark this line so that you can be sure the top bifold track is level and in proper alignment with the jambs.

Once the doors have been installed after installation, insert the top pin of the pivot guide of the track. Then, you can swivel the bottom of the door until the pin rests in the bracket that is shaped like an L. If the door does not fit between the top bracket and the bottom guide, you can raise or lower it by uncrewing the pivot that is adjustable at the bottom of the doors. Verify that the gap between the door and the hinge-side jamb is equal by using a long level and drawing an arc of plumb across the center of the door frame.

Reinstall the top pin

A bifold door is a set of hinged panels that fold back onto tracks to the other side of the door opening. They are available in a variety of styles, including doors made of solid or paneled materials as well as louvered doors. They can be used in hallways, closets, bedrooms, or laundry rooms. If you have an existing pair of bifold doors that scrape the floor or aren't functioning properly, it's possible to adjust them by altering the pivots on the top and bottom.

Begin by removing top pin from the upper track and pivot guide. Slide the bottom pin into the bracket and check if there's an even and correct gap between the jamb side of the frame and the door.

If the gap is too wide You can raise the bottom of the door by loosening and fixing the pivot adjustable on the bottom of the door. This will push the door's bottom towards the frame, decreasing the gap. You can adjust the track hanger's height by loosening the screw at the bottom of the track, and then adjusting the height using a wrench.

Install the top track bracket on the hinge end of the door frame once you have put back the track hanger. Follow the directions and diagrams included in the kit to determine the exact position. Make sure that the track is aligned and flush with the floor prior to securing it in place.

When installing a track, measure the length and width of the door opening to be certain that you have the correct dimension of track and the appropriate hardware kit.
